The AZ1117EH-ADJTRG1 belongs to the category of adjustable linear voltage regulators.
It is commonly used to provide a stable and adjustable output voltage for various electronic circuits and devices.
The AZ1117EH-ADJTRG1 is available in a TO-252 package, also known as DPAK, which provides efficient heat dissipation.
The essence of this product lies in its ability to regulate and stabilize voltage levels within electronic systems, ensuring reliable performance.
It is typically packaged in reels or tubes and is available in varying quantities based on customer requirements.
The AZ1117EH-ADJTRG1 has three pins: 1. Input (VIN) 2. Ground (GND) 3. Output (VOUT)
The AZ1117EH-ADJTRG1 operates by comparing the reference voltage with the divided output voltage to maintain a stable output. It adjusts the pass transistor to regulate the output voltage, providing a constant and accurate level.
This regulator is widely used in various applications, including: - Battery-powered devices - Embedded systems - Industrial automation - Consumer electronics - Automotive electronics
